Makes about 8 and 1/4 Popsicles.
Ingredients:
- 2 1/2 cups seeded diced watermelon
- 1/2 cup fresh raspberries or frozen unsweetened, thawed
- 6 tablespoons sugar
- 1 tablespoon plus 2 teaspoons fresh lemon juice
- 1 tablespoon crème de cassis (black currant-flavored liqueur) or light corn syrup
Preparation:
- Combine all ingredients in blender; puree until smooth.
- Strain into 2-cup glass measuring cup, pressing on solids to extract as much liquid as possible.
- Pour puree into Popsicle molds, dividing equally.
- Freeze overnight. (Can be prepared 1 week ahead. Keep frozen.)
